Output 528b5f8d25b7d1dd55eba03aeb89e0549e6d854463167a32af328ab51924c388:13

value
284235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df57bfda57c66a11d5dcbb98ad798405469b65e1 OP_EQUAL
address
3N3wjFyCFic592kKUckE1QzoBHH5fvSjfn
transaction
528b5f8d25b7d1dd55eba03aeb89e0549e6d854463167a32af328ab51924c388
confirmations
227003
spent
true